The circuit design of YGE series modules developed by Yingli has been optimized. Every piece of cells parallels a diode, when a cell is covered by shade, the paralleled diode can bypass this cell, thus avoide hot spot, and can retain the maximum power output.


HSF module can be used in more shadowy and xomplex areas. Meanwhile, in land scarcity areas, the distance between modules has been shortened to increase the installed capacity.

FEATURES
- High Power Density : An increased power density of the modules leads to a smaller footprint of your system and a decrease in specific system costs. - Low Light Behavior : YGE Black Silicon Series modules are highly sensitive for photons and continue to produce energy even at low light levels. - PID Resistant : Tested to the industry’s most rigorous durability standards, YGE Black Silicon Series modules are PID-resistant in accordance to IEC 62804. To ensure PID-resistance at higher system voltages, these cells receive an extra layer of protective silicon nitride. - Advanced Glass : Our high-transmission glass features a unique anti-reflective coating that directs more light on the solar cells, resulting in a higher energy yield.
THERMAL CHARACTERISTICS
NOMINAL OPERATING CELL TEMPERATURE | NOCT | °C | 46 +/- 2 |
---|---|---|---|
Temperature coefficient of Pmax | γ | %/°C | -0.42 |
Temperature coefficient of Voc | βVoc | %/°C | -0.32 |
Temperature coefficient of Isc | αlsc | %/°C | 0.05 |
